“It was very big to think about everything and everywhere. Only God could do that.” quote by James Joyce
Download Open image
““It was very big to think about everything and everywhere. Only God could do that.””

James Joyce

About This Quote

Source Novel: A Portrait of the Artist as a Young Man, James Joyce, 1916

The vastness of divine capability is beyond human comprehension, emphasizing humility before a higher power.

In simple terms: God can do everything, humans cannot.
